What is insurance for SR22 ?

SR22 insurance, typically referred to as SR-22, is a vehicle liability insurance record required by a lot of state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) offices for certain motorists. This insurance works as proof that a car driver has actually the minimum called for liability insurance coverage from the state. The significance of it is that it permits the car driver to preserve or renew driving privileges after particular traffic-related offenses. It's important to understand that it is not a kind of auto insurance, but a verification that the insurance company attests the car driver, assuring to cover any type of future insurance claims.

The requirement for an SR-22 kind indicates that the person has actually had a gap in insurance coverage or has been associated with an accident without enough insurance to cover damages. The insurance company issues the SR-22 forms to the state DMV to confirm the vehicle driver's financial responsibility, showing they are currently suitably insured. The SR-22 is a time-bound demand, which indicates it is not a permanent mark on a vehicle driver's document. This process makes certain that the driver carries at the very least the minimum liability insurance the states mandate. Hence, SR-22 Insurance plays a crucial duty in building count on in between the insurer and the guaranteed.

Just how much does SR-22 insurance price?

The price of SR-22 insurance can differ widely based on various factors such as a person's driving record, the factor for the SR-22 requirement, and the state where the car driver resides. The prompt economic impact comes in the type of a filing fee, which generally varies from $15 to $25. However, the a lot more considerable cost originates from the expected increase in auto insurance rate. The statement of a plan lapse resulting in a requirement for SR-22 draws the representation of the vehicle driver as high threat in the eyes of auto insurance service providers. A high-risk label can connect significantly to the walking in month-to-month prices.

Further complicating the cost estimation is the type of insurance coverage needed to have. While a non-owner car insurance policy might cost less than an owner's policy, the explicit demand for a raised quantity of coverage can rise costs. Most states mandate a minimal quantity of liability insurance coverage, consisting of both bodily injury and property damage liability, of which a fair quantity needs to be shown in the insurance policy bundled with the SR-22 kind. To add fuel to the fire, in some states like Florida and Virginia, FR-44 insurance, which requires also higher liability insurance coverage, may be a required. Essentially, while the actual fee of filing an SR-22 form is fairly low, the indirect prices resulting from its influence on auto insurance rates and liability insurance requirements can create a hole in your pocket.

What's the distinction between SR-22 and FR-44?

SR-22 and FR-44 are both kinds of insurance accreditations made use of by states to confirm a vehicle driver's financial responsibility and ensure they fulfill the corresponding state's minimum auto insurance requirements. The significant difference in between these certificates primarily hinges on the objective they offer and the liability limits. With an SR-22, usually required for individuals with Drunk drivings or major driving offenses, the liability requirements are similar to those of a typical automobile insurance policy. This accreditation can be acquired by including it to a current policy or by safeguarding a non-owner policy if the person doesn't own a vehicle.

FR-44, on the other hand, is specific to 2 states-- Virginia and Florida, and includes higher liability limits, specifically for bodily injury liability. It's normally mandated for people needing a hardship license after a substantial driving offense, such as a DUI where injury or substantial property damage happened. Additionally, FR-44 filing period is typically longer and the average cost more than that of SR-22, due to the enhanced insurance coverage it requires. The advantages of keeping a valid license with an FR-44 filing featured the rigorous condition of keeping a clean record and maintaining comprehensive coverage throughout the necessary period. This assures the state of the individual's commitment to much safer, a lot more accountable driving in the future.

What takes place if an SR-22 insurance policy is terminated?

The termination of an SR-22 insurance policy can typically cause serious effects. When an insurance holder's SR-22 insurance is canceled - whether as a result of non-payment, plan lapse, or any other reason - insurance service providers have an obligation to inform the proper state authorities about this change. This is achieved by filing an SR-26 form, which successfully signifies completion of the policyholder's SR-22 insurance protection.

When the proper state authorities have actually been informed of the cancellation of SR-22 insurance, the impacted car driver's permit might possibly be put on hold again. This is due to the authorities' need to guarantee that the drivers are continuously guaranteed while they are having the SR-22 requirement. Therefore, the driver might have to seek non-owner SR-22 insurance if the auto was not in their possession at the time of the cancellation. This reinstatement of the car driver's SR-22 requirement can cause more headaches down the line, as well as possible boosts in insurance premiums. Proactivity in preserving an SR-22 insurance policy is extremely recommended to prevent such scenarios.
